1. In-stream work and land disturbance within the 25-foot wide buffer zone are prohibited during the trout spawning
season of October 15 through April 15 to protect the egg and fry stages of trout from sedimentation during
construction.
2. " Stormwater should be directed to buffer areas or retention basins and should not be routed directly into streams.
3. High Quality Waters Erosion Control Guidelines must be implemented prior to any ground-disturbing activities to
minimize impacts to downstream aquatic resources. Temporary or permanent herbaceous vegetation should be
planted on all bare soil within 15 days of ground-disturbing activities to provide long term erosion control.
4. The culvert required for this project shall be installed in such a manner that the original stream profile is not altered
(i.e. the depth of the channel should not be reduced by a widening of the streambed).
5. All work shall be performed during low flow conditions.
6. All mechanized equipment operated near surface waters should be regularly inspected and maintained to prevent
contamination of stream waters from fuels, lubricants, hydraulic fluids, or other toxic materials.
7. The presence of equipment in the channels must be minimized. Under no circumstances should rock, sand or other
materials be dredged from the wetted stream channel under authorization of this permit, except in the immediate
vicinity of the culverts.
8. Mowing of existing vegetated buffers is strongly discouraged, so that they may be utilized for storm water sheet flow.
9. Use of rip-rap for bank stabilization- is to be minimized; rather, native vegetation is to be planted when practical. If
necessary, rip-rap should be limited to the stream bank below the high water mark, and vegetation should be used for
stabilization above high water.
10. Rock silt screens at culvert outlets should be removed at project completion.

The North Carolina Department of Transportation (NCDOT) is proposing to grade, drain,
base and pave SR 1233, Big Horse Branch Road, primarily along the existing roadway. In order
to construct this project in accordance with our current secondary road standards and due to the
proximity of a trout stream (Horse Branch and tributaries, DEM Class C - Trout Water) and
extension of pipe culverts, we are requesting (a renewal) of NWP 14 (Action Id. 199930795)
received by this office on May 24, 1999. Attached is a copy of the original approval of NWP 26
for the subject roadway.
I am sending a straight-line diagram with the proposed erosion control, stream, stream
bank, and construction limits and various sites along the project where we will be in conflict with
the stream. In addition, I am sending a typical section of the road, cross sections, drawings for
pipe culvert replacements, general notes and standards on some erosion control measures, and a
marked map. We propose to install all the new culverts slightly below the existing streambed
elevations where bedrock is not encountered to minimize impacts to wildlife habitats and allow
the existing stream gradients to remain as unchanged as is physically possible. No threatened or -
b
Fr7
endangered species are known to be present in or near the project area; therefore, no significant
impacts are anticipated from project construction.
C-j
The best management practices will be used to minimize and control sedimentation and ~
erosion on this project. The construction foreman will review all erosion control measures daily
to ensure sedimentation and erosion are being effectively controlled. If the planned devices are
not functioning as intended, they will immediately be replaced with better devices. The rocksilt
screens and other erosion control devices will be in place prior to pipe culvert construction and
will remain in place until the project is stabilized.

The applicant proposes to replace/extend 2 culvert structures and work in the trout water buffer zone in
association with roadway improvements. Big Horse Branch is a tributary to Panther Creek. which is managed by
the NCWRC as Hatchery Supported trout water. Both of these streams provide excellent habitat and support wild
trout populations in the project area. The NCWRC is concerned about potential project impacts to trout and other
aquatic resources in this drainage; however, , nc@-of_=a 4t?4 permit prQ,Nrrded:tlle"following tin Mn ndit orTS` IMe rt fte, subject permit.;-
1. High Quality Waters Erosion Control Guidelines must be implemented prior to any ground disturbing
activities to minimize impacts to downstream aquatic resources. Temporary or permanent herbaceous
vegetation should be planted on all bare soil within 15 days of ground disturbing activities to provide
long-tern erosion control.
2. The culverts should be placed with the floor of the barrels approximately one foot below the level of
the stream bottom to allow natural stream bottom materials to become established in the culvert and
to allow fish passage during periods of low flow. This may require increasing the size of the culvert
to meet flow conveyance requirements. The NCWRC recommends that a pipe arch (CSPA) be used
to replace the 60-inch CMP at Site 1.
Under no circumstances should rock, sand, or other materials be dredged from the wetted stream
channel under authorization of this permit, except in the immediate vicinity of the culverts. Instream
dredging has catastrophic effects on aquatic life, and disturbance of the natural form of the stream
channel will likely cause downstream erosion problems, possibly affecting other landowners.
4. If concrete is used during culvert installation (headwalls), a dry work area should be maintained to
prevent direct contact between curing concrete and stream water. Uncured concrete affects water
quality and is highly toxic to fish and other aquatic organisms.
5. Natural materials should be used as much as possible to restore stream banks at crossings. Riprap
should be limited to the stream bank below the high water mark, and vegetation should be used for
stabilization above high water.
6. Construction within the 25-foot buffer zone is prohibited during the trout spawning period of
November 1 to April 15 in order to protect the egg and fry stages from sedimentation.
7. Rock silt screens at culvert outlets should be removed at project completion.
8. Stormwater should be directed to buffer areas or retention basins and should not be routed directly
into streams.
9. All mechanized equipment operated near surface waters should be regularly inspected and maintained
to prevent contamination of stream waters from fuels, lubricants. hydraulic fluids, or other toxic
materials.
